使用.NET项目文件和架构?

时间:2010-03-30 19:36:01

标签: .net visual-studio xsd

我正在开发一个项目,要求我获取各种.vbproj和.csproj文件,并确定它们构建的Visual Studio版本,然后获取输出dll名称等信息。

有谁知道这些文件是否有可用的架构?谷歌和MSDN搜索有点空白。

Visual Studio版本

我还应该注意,我需要以下版本的Visual Studio

  • Visual Studio 2003(仅限VB语言)
  • Visual Studio 2005(VB和C#)
  • Visual Studio 2008(VB和C#)
  • Visual Studio 2010(VB和C#)

2 个答案:

答案 0 :(得分:3)

VS使用的大部分模式都等同于

  

C:\ Program Files \ Microsoft Visual   Studio 9.0 \ Xml \ Schemas

项目文件周围的文件位于MSBuild子目录中,您可以使用

  

C:\ Program Files \ Microsoft Visual   工作室   9.0 \ XML \架构\ 1033 \的MSBuild \ Microsoft.Build.Core.xsd

祝你好运!

答案 1 :(得分:0)

如果编辑项目文件(卸载,然后以XML格式打开文件),您将在Property Grid的Schemas属性中看到正在使用哪些模式。